The State Insurance Fund (SIF) is established to provide funding support
to the Employees' Compensation Program. It is generated from the
employers' contributions collected by both GSIS and SSS from public and
private sectors employers respectively.
Under existing rules, a government agency, unit or office shall remit to
the GSIS a monthly contribution of Php100 per employee (Board Resolution
No. 02-04-235 issued on April 11, 2002). For a covered employee in the
private sector, the employer shall remit to the SSS a
monthly contribution of Php10 for wages earners and 0.20% of the monthly
salary credit (MSC) for employees with higher MSC of P15,000.00 and over
(Board Resolution NO. 06-08-70 issued on August 31, 2006). |
